Mozilla's 'cq' Project Aims to Revolutionize Coding AI with Real-Time Knowledge Sharing
By Freecker • 2026-03-25T00:00:42.758185
In a bid to address a critical weakness in coding AI, Mozilla developer Peter Wilson has introduced 'cq', a novel project that draws inspiration from Stack Overflow. This ambitious endeavor seeks to provide coding agents with access to up-to-date, reliable information, thereby mitigating the issues stemming from outdated knowledge and redundant problem-solving.
The concept of 'cq' is built around the realization that current coding agents often rely on outdated information, leading to inefficient decision-making processes. This is largely due to training cutoffs and the lack of structured access to real-time context. To counter this, 'cq' aims to establish a knowledge-sharing platform where agents can draw from a collective pool of experiences, thus reducing the need for repetitive problem-solving.
The implications of 'cq' are far-reaching, with potential benefits extending to both developers and the environment. By minimizing the need for redundant computations, 'cq' could significantly reduce energy consumption associated with AI operations. Furthermore, the real-time knowledge sharing facilitated by 'cq' could lead to more efficient and accurate coding agents, ultimately enhancing the overall development process.
For everyday users, the impact of 'cq' might not be immediately apparent, but the long-term benefits could be substantial. As coding agents become more efficient and accurate, the applications they power are likely to become more reliable and responsive. This, in turn, could lead to improved user experiences across a wide range of digital services.
From an industry perspective, 'cq' has the potential to reshape how AI is developed and deployed. By addressing the critical issue of knowledge sharing among coding agents, 'cq' could pave the way for more sophisticated and efficient AI systems. This shift could have significant implications for businesses, as they seek to leverage AI to drive innovation and competitiveness.
The success of 'cq', however, will depend on its ability to address key challenges such as security, data poisoning, and accuracy. As the project moves forward, it will be crucial to ensure that these issues are adequately addressed, thereby paving the way for widespread adoption and realizing the full potential of 'cq'.
The concept of 'cq' is built around the realization that current coding agents often rely on outdated information, leading to inefficient decision-making processes. This is largely due to training cutoffs and the lack of structured access to real-time context. To counter this, 'cq' aims to establish a knowledge-sharing platform where agents can draw from a collective pool of experiences, thus reducing the need for repetitive problem-solving.
The implications of 'cq' are far-reaching, with potential benefits extending to both developers and the environment. By minimizing the need for redundant computations, 'cq' could significantly reduce energy consumption associated with AI operations. Furthermore, the real-time knowledge sharing facilitated by 'cq' could lead to more efficient and accurate coding agents, ultimately enhancing the overall development process.
For everyday users, the impact of 'cq' might not be immediately apparent, but the long-term benefits could be substantial. As coding agents become more efficient and accurate, the applications they power are likely to become more reliable and responsive. This, in turn, could lead to improved user experiences across a wide range of digital services.
From an industry perspective, 'cq' has the potential to reshape how AI is developed and deployed. By addressing the critical issue of knowledge sharing among coding agents, 'cq' could pave the way for more sophisticated and efficient AI systems. This shift could have significant implications for businesses, as they seek to leverage AI to drive innovation and competitiveness.
The success of 'cq', however, will depend on its ability to address key challenges such as security, data poisoning, and accuracy. As the project moves forward, it will be crucial to ensure that these issues are adequately addressed, thereby paving the way for widespread adoption and realizing the full potential of 'cq'.